Proclamation - Recognizing the launch of the Treasure Coast Manufacturers' Association (TCMA) in St. Lucie County, Florida. Chairman Johnson expressed his excitement over the formation of the Treasure Coast Manufacturers' Association. Jerry Jacques from Advanced Machine and Tool accepted the proclamation as the TCMA President. He spoke about the hard work and passion that went into creating the group. He also mentioned the benefits the group will provide the community, including education and training and stronger relationships with local government. He explained the TCMA's goal of educating local businesses on the resources available to them. Tammy Roncaglione from Center State Bank also addressed the Board. She announced the official kickoff event for the Treasure Coast Manufacturers' Association. Ms. Roncaglione spoke about the positive reception of the group by manufacturers. She offered the Board an opportunity to tour local manufacturing operations. She emphasized the value of manufacturing jobs in the county. Pete Tesch from the Economic Development Council also addressed the Board. He indicated that the EDC is excited to provide support to the TCMA. He added that the County's Business Navigator has been a valuable asset to local employers. Mr. Tesch explained the progress of working with manufacturers to ensure St. Lucie County is pro -growth, pro -business and pro - manufacturing. Chairman Johnson thanked county staff for their work assisting the TCMA. NACIO Award Presentation - Nicole Fogarty, Legislative Affairs Manager 2 1 P a g e Regular Meeting Tuesday, August 2, 2016 6:00 PM The County Legislative Affairs Manager spoke about the National Association of Counties conference. She stated that St. Lucie County received 7 awards, including best in show for the county's public service announcement series on single stream recycling. She introduced the county's Communications Division Director to accept the award. Staff explained that this is the tenth consecutive year that St. Lucie County has received awards from the National Association of County Information Officers, but this is the first best in show award. He noted that the county received awards for 5 of their 6 entries, including awards for media coverage of the student transit program, the county Facebook page, and the redesign of the county website. The Communications Division Director thanked staff for their hard work and cooperation. B. 2016 Chili Cook -Off Awards Presentation - Ed Matthews, Parks, Rec & Facilities Director The Director of the Parks, Recreation and Facilities Department presented the Board with the results of the 2016 Chili Cook -Off. He announced that St. Lucie County won 7 awards at the event that took place at the Fenn Center on July 16th. Staff explained that the fundraiser benefited the Boys & Girls Club of St. Lucie County and raised over $63,000 through the combined effort of 35 organizations. The Director of Parks, Recreation and Facilities thanked his staff who organized the event. Staff thanked the various departments involved; Community Services, Veterans Services, the IT Department, Environmental Resources, Parks, Recreation and Facilities, Human Resources and the Oxbow Center. He commended staff that volunteered and brought their families to participate as well. He listed the awards won by the county: 1st place for best costuming, 1st place for the government award, Lorna Thompson won the Little Miss Chili Pepper competition, 2nd place for best chili, 3rd place for booth decorations, 3rd place for the overall challenge award and 3rd place for fundraising. The Board of County Commissioner's booth brought in $3802 for the Boys & Girls Club. Staff thanked the Board for allowing the team to represent them at the event and presented them with the awards.
